MEMPHIS, Tenn. — There are a few weeks left until the state and federal 2024 General Election on Nov. 5.
Early voting in Tennessee started Oct. 16. and runs until Oct. 31. Those wishing to vote absentee in either must request an absentee ballot by Oct. 29.
A list of early voting locations in Shelby County can be viewed HERE. Most polling sites will be open from 11 a.m. to 7 p.m. on week days and 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. on Saturdays. No voting locations are open on Sundays.
Voters can expect to make selections for the United States President, Senate and House of Representatives.
Memphians will vote on charter amendment ordinances. Specifically, three gun safety measures that fought their way to the ballot.
